Taraji P. Henson opens up about her struggle with depression and anxiety

Taraji P. Henson opened up about her struggle with depression and anxiety during an interview with Variety Magazine. The star shared that her stardom has come with a lot of pressure which has contributed to her own mental health issues. She said in part’ ”I suffer from depression. My anxiety is kicking up even more every day, and I’ve never really dealt with anxiety like that. It’s something new.”

Image: Taraji P. Henson IG

Taraji also revealed that in an effort to keep her mental health in good shape, she sees a therapist and occasionally takes a break from social media. “You can talk to your friends, but you need a professional who can give you exercises. So that when you’re on the ledge, you have things to say to yourself that will get you off that ledge and past your weakest moments,” she said.

Taraji launched her foundation, the Boris Lawrence Henson Foundation, named after her father, which is aimed at eradicating the stigma surrounding mental health.
